| Year | 2016 |
|---|---|
| Engine Type | Single cylinder, 4-stroke |
| Cooling System | Liquid |
| Transmission | 6-speed |
| Clutch | Wet, multi-disc |
| Front Tire | 90/90-21 |
| Rear Tire | 140/80-18 |
| Compression Ratio | 12.0:1 |
| Starter | Electric |
| Category | Enduro |
| Torque | 45 Nm (33.2 ft*lbs) @ 6750 rpm |
| Fuel System | Injection. Mikuni D42 |
| Frame | Steel trellis |
| Front Suspension | Upside down telescopic hydraulic fork |
| Rear Suspension | Monoshock, adjustable |
| Front Brake | Single disc |
| Rear Brake | Single disc, 240 mm |
| Seat Height | 963 mm |
| Wheelbase | 1495 mm |
| Fuel Capacity | 7.2 liters |
| Displacement | 501 cm3 |
